Transaction fd5d896ce36298ff0de2ce5da8e50575746dfe869c296b076bb508f664075407
1 Input
1 Output
-
fd5d896ce36298ff0de2ce5da8e50575746dfe869c296b076bb508f664075407:0
- value
- 42024675
- script pubkey
- OP_0 OP_PUSHBYTES_20 b6ee0af6fd7cae8ac286958bb8e96ca051d36569
- address
- bc1qkmhq4aha0jhg4s5xjk9m36tv5pgaxetfmszhc3